The world's attention will be focused on the San Francisco Bay come 2013 for the America's Cup. The event promise of bringing the world of sailing to all will be fulfilled through the introduction of exciting, high-performance, wing-sailed catamarans that will demand the best from the sailors, challenging their athleticism as never before. And for the first time in America’s Cup history, the action will be brought directly to the spectator, through onboard cameramen, enhanced broadcasting and a robust social media offering.
